Captured in the soft morning light of Mottingham, this close-up of an opulent bridal bouquet reveals a masterful layering of blooms and foliage. Prominent among them are the striking white Oriental lilies-their smooth petals marked with faint freckles, the centres ablaze with yellow stamens-that take pride of place. White lisianthus blooms cluster throughout, ruffled petals edged with the softest strokes of lavender offering a romantic blur amid the ivory and green. Deeper purple, almost indigo, accents draw the eye upward, likely provided by spires of Veronica, which add height and movement to the composition. Wispy clouds of baby's breath soften the entire bouquet, imparting a weightless, ethereal quality reminiscent of Mottingham's open skies. Around the edge, lush greenery abounds: unopened lily buds, broad leaves with a deep glossy finish, and cascading asparagus fern bring natural structure and vitality, inspired by the foliage of Elmstead Woods nearby. The bride's perfectly groomed hands, brushed with a light polish, hold the stems securely against the soft, blurred white of a traditional strapless dress. The beauty of White Lilium, White-purple Lisianthus, Purple Veronica, Gypsophila and Aralia leaves is unparalleled.

This arrangement containsthe following flowers:

  • White lilium
  • White-purple lisianthus
  • Purple veronica
  • Gypsophila
  • Aralia leaves
